"Monster" is a psychological thriller anime series that originally aired from 2004 to 2005. The series was produced by Madhouse and consists of 74 episodes. It is based on the manga of the same name by Naoki Urasawa.
The story takes place in Germany and revolves around Dr. Kenzo Tenma, a Japanese neurosurgeon who saves the life of a young boy named Johan Liebert, who was shot in the head. However, Johan turns out to be a psychopathic killer who goes on to commit numerous murders. Tenma becomes obsessed with stopping Johan and understanding the reasons behind his actions. To understand the weight of Monster, you must understand its premise. The year is 1986. Dr. Kenzo Tenma is a brilliant Japanese neurosurgeon working at a prestigious hospital in Düsseldorf, Germany. He is engaged to the director’s daughter and is on the fast track to career success—until he makes a choice.
Forced to choose between operating on a famous opera singer or a young, unnamed boy who was shot in the head, Tenma remembers the words of a dying patient: "All lives are equal." He defies the hospital director, saves the boy, and loses everything—his reputation, his fiancée, and his future.

Nine years later, a string of grotesque, seemingly unrelated murders plagues Germany. Tenma discovers that the boy he saved has grown up to become a charismatic serial killer—a "monster" capable of manipulating anyone to commit murder. Wanted by the police for a murder he didn’t commit, Tenma embarks on a cross-continental journey to "correct his mistake" and stop Johan before he completes his dark apocalypse.

In the pantheon of anime, few titles command the same level of quiet, terrifying respect as Monster. Based on the acclaimed manga by Naoki Urasawa (often called the "God of Manga"), the anime adaptation is a 74-episode slow-burn thriller that abandons superheroes and mechas for something far more chilling: the human soul.
